Output 00c58efc28701d817515bb37ccb409eeaea95d309bcd3d451dfe908d1abe76d1:0

value
15000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 caa9416712b39a3ec8b6c3e604aa84ec078c33b9 OP_EQUALVERIFY OP_CHECKSIG
address
1KUaFpwfcouyzDA5ZvDAoSSPbwyzhmDC2G
transaction
00c58efc28701d817515bb37ccb409eeaea95d309bcd3d451dfe908d1abe76d1
confirmations
144956
spent
true